- Home
- Remote Jobs
- Senior Staff Engineer, UI
Date Posted
Today
New!Remote Work Level
Hybrid Remote
Location
Hybrid Remote in New York, NY
Job Schedule
Full-Time
Salary
$135,375 - $216,684 Annually
Benefits
Unlimited or Flexible PTO Health Insurance Dental Insurance Vision Insurance Parental Leave Retirement Savings Education Assistance Disability Paid Time Off Career Development
Categories
Tech Support, Design, Product Manager, Project Manager, Software Engineer, Developer, Front End Developer, Full Stack Developer, Web Developer
About the Role
Title: Senior Staff Engineer, UI
Location: New York, NY United States
Hybrid
Job Description:
Company description
Publicis Media Exchange (PMX) is the investment arm of Publicis Media, supercharging our agencies and clients to drive smart application of investment by leveraging scale, marketplace innovation, deeper partnerships, and intelligence. PMX is at the forefront of the converging marketplace, solving industry challenges and executing data-informed, tech-enabled media to help marketers connect with consumers in a measurable way.
Overview
We're looking for a Senior UI Engineer to help lead the technical direction of Agent Studio, Performics' flagship AI-driven workspace. You'll be a senior-level individual contributor who partners closely with product, UX, and platform leads to architect, implement, and optimize modern front-end systems that power real-time, AI-augmented experiences.
This is a hands-on, non-supervisory role - ideal for engineers who thrive at the intersection of design systems, performance, and architectural decision-making. This is a hands-on engineering role - you'll contribute directly to production code, build pipelines, and review implementations while shaping the long-term frontend architecture.
You'll shape engineering best practices, mentor developers across teams, and drive consistency across Studio's growing product surface.
Responsibilities
Core Responsibilities
- Lead the technical design, implementation, and optimization of Agent Studio's React +
- TypeScript + Next.js front-end architecture.
- Define patterns for modular component design, code reuse, and performance optimization (<500ms response time).
- Partner with backend and AI Orchestration teams to optimize real-time streaming (SSE/WebSocket) and integration flows.
- Establish coding standards, code review practices, and automated quality gates (Jest, Cypress, Playwright).
- Architect reusable front-end modules and shared libraries across Agent Studio's chat, workflow, and project modules.
- Collaborate with UX and design system teams to expand the ShadCN / Tailwind design system for conversational and dashboard components.
- Serve as the front-end architectural point of contact for AOE, DFP, and SRE charters, ensuring cohesive runtime integration.
- Implement CI/CD and observability instrumentation (GitHub Actions, DataDog) to improve developer efficiency and visibility.
Technical Leadership & Collaboration
- Mentor junior engineers through design reviews, pairing, and coaching on performance and testing strategies.
- Participate in architectural reviews and influence the evolution of OneSuite's front-end framework standards.
- Drive experimentation with emerging frameworks, SDKs, and rendering patterns (Server Components, AI SDKs).
Partner with the Engineering Manager to define sprint-level technical goals and engineering OKRs.
- Innovation & System Design
- Lead prototyping efforts for complex UX or interaction patterns (multi-agent chat, dynamic context panels, real-time analytics).
- Shape strategies for performance observability, caching, and versioned prompt or workflow interfaces.
- Contribute to post-launch monitoring, debugging, and scaling strategies for production releases.
Qualifications
Must Have
- 5-7 years of professional experience in front-end or full-stack web application development.
- Expert-level proficiency in React, TypeScript, and modern JavaScript.
- Deep understanding of Next.js, component lifecycle, and rendering optimization.
- Proven experience architecting scalable UI systems and shared component libraries.
- Strong familiarity with testing frameworks (Jest, Cypress, Playwright) and performance profiling tools.
- Experience integrating RESTful and streaming APIs (SSE/WebSocket).
- Solid grounding in accessibility, security, and responsive design principles.
- Familiarity with CI/CD pipelines and DevOps collaboration.
Nice to Have
- Experience in data-intensive or AI-augmented applications.
- Understanding of FastAPI, AWS Bedrock AgentCore, or LiteLLM frameworks.
- Exposure to observability and monitoring platforms (DataDog, CloudWatch).
- Prior experience leading architecture initiatives or framework migrations.
Core Competencies
- As a Senior Engineer, you lead through deep technical expertise and architectural influence rather than direct management.
- Technical: You drive the design and implementation of complex systems and high-impact features, setting the technical direction for Agent Studio's front-end architecture. You ensure scalability, maintainability, and performance across projects, while championing clean code practices and reusable patterns that accelerate development efficiency.
- Leadership: You provide technical guidance to peers and junior engineers, fostering a culture of excellence through code reviews, knowledge sharing, and example-driven mentorship. Though not a supervisory role, you lead through influence - shaping engineering standards and decision-making within and beyond your immediate team.
- Product Impact: Your work has measurable outcomes on both the product and its users.
- You translate business and design goals into reliable, high-performance technical solutions that directly improve user experience, product metrics, and developer productivity. You anticipate technical risks early and ensure solutions are built for long-term scalability and reliability.
- Innovation & Learning: You stay ahead of emerging frameworks, performance optimization strategies, and front-end architecture trends, introducing improvements that elevate Agent Studio's overall engineering maturity. You experiment thoughtfully, balancing innovation with stability, and help the team adopt new tools or approaches when they provide tangible value.
- Collaboration: You communicate complex technical ideas with clarity and empathy across cross-functional teams - including Product, UX, and AI Orchestration. You build consensus, align diverse stakeholders around engineering decisions, and represent frontend engineering effectively in architecture and design discussions across OneSuite charters.
Why Join Us
- Help define the technical foundation of Performics' flagship product at global scale.
- Collaborate with a multi-disciplinary team of AI, design, and data experts.
- Work in an environment that values technical depth, mentorship, and experimentation.
- Hybrid flexibility, AI-assisted dev tools, and clear growth paths into Staff Engineer or Principal Front-End Architect roles.
- Competitive compensation, benefits, and professional development program
Additional information
Our Publicis Groupe motto "Viva La Différence" means we're better together, and we believe that our differences make us stronger. It means we honor and celebrate all identities, across all facets of intersectionality, and it underpins all that we do as an organization. We are focused on fostering belonging and creating equitable & inclusive experiences for all talent.
Publicis Groupe provides robust and inclusive benefit programs and policies to support the evolving and diverse needs of our talent and enable every person to grow and thrive. Our benefits package includes medical coverage, dental, vision, disability, 401K, as well as parental and family care leave, family forming assistance, tuition reimbursement, and flexible time off.
Compensation Range: $135,375- $216,684 annually. This is the pay range the Company believes it will pay for this position at the time of this posting. Consistent with applicable law, compensation will be determined based on the skills, qualifications, and experience of the applicant along with the requirements of the position, and the Company reserves the right to modify this pay range at any time. Temporary roles may be eligible to participate in our freelancer/temporary employee medical plan through a third-party benefits administration system once certain criteria have been met. Temporary roles may also qualify for participation in our 401(k) plan after eligibility criteria have been met. For regular roles, the Company will offer medical coverage, dental, vision, disability, 401k, and paid time off.
#LI-BL2